Promoting Leadership
Leadership is not so much about positions and titles. It is about a process and activities to mobilize oneself, groups, organizations and societies to face and address challenges and changes ahead.
People who exercise leadership are striving to engage, progress, succeed and sustain what they create.
Organizations that allow people to exercise leadership throughout hierarchies are continuously learning and improving, are resilient to turbulences and deliver outstanding results.
Leadership makes an organization alive.

The goal is to develop capabilities and opportunities to mobilize individuals and groups for change.
